73380CS - 16" Oil Tempered Compression Spring

Inventory Status
Estimated Lead Time

Compression spring manufactured from oil tempered with 16.6 coils and closed & ground ends. This spring features an O.D. of 3.656", and an I.D. of 2.87".

The compression spring 73380CS is an essential component designed for applications requiring reliable force and energy storage. Crafted from high-quality oil tempered, the 73380 compression spring design exhibits exceptional tensile strength and resilience.

The 73380 design is manufactured with a free length of 16", with an outer diameter of 3.656", an inner diameter of 2.87", and a total of 16.6 coils, expertly designed to deliver consistent compression characteristics including a rate of 68 lbs/in.

The 73380CS compression spring is ideally suited for use in a wide range of mechanical assemblies, including but not limited to automotive suspension systems, industrial machinery, and electronic devices.
